Acquire has connections between some of the games to, particularly between the Way of the Samurai and Shinobido games. I'm pretty sure the fanbase for either one of these series is rather minor, so I'm probably sure nobody else has posted about it.
- Nomi, one of the characters from the first and third WotS games who serves as the instructor to the game mechanics appears in Shinobido: Tales of the Ninja as an unlockable character once you complete the game 100%.
- Zaji, one of the important characters in Shinobido: Way of the Ninja and Tales of the Ninja, appears in WotS3 as a hired ninja in one of the possible storylines of the game.
- Rokkotsu Pass, the location of the first WotS is also present in cutscenes in the original Shinobido as a resting grounds for the Kenobi Clan, one of the three ninja factions in the game. The cutscenes also include cameos from Suzu and Kurikichi, the two characters who run the restaurant during the events of WotS.
Another example of a pretty niche crossover involves the company Falcom and one of their games, Ys vs Sora No Kiseki: Alternative Saga. It dominantly features characters from the Ys series and the Legend of Heroes games, but includes tons of assist characters from many of Falcom's games.
